Cavities and Dental DecayLearn More ➝ List Item 1
Cavities form when bacteria weaken the enamel and create small holes in the teeth. Left untreated, decay can spread deeper and cause pain or infection. We restore your teeth with gentle, tooth-colored fillings and preventive care to stop cavities early.

Cracked and Chipped TeethLearn More ➝
Accidents, grinding, or biting hard foods can lead to cracks or chips that affect both function and appearance. Depending on severity, we can repair damaged teeth with bonding, veneers, inlays, onlays, or crowns to protect your smile and restore strength.

Failing, Missing, or Knocked Out TeethLearn More ➝
Tooth loss can occur from decay, trauma, or gum disease, while a knocked-out tooth requires immediate attention. We offer lasting solutions such as dental implants, bridges, and dentures to restore chewing ability, speech, and confidence.

Toothaches and Sensitive TeethLearn More ➝
Tooth pain or sensitivity may result from decay, enamel erosion, or gum recession. We carefully diagnose the cause through exams and X-rays, then provide treatments such as fillings, protective restorations, or root canals to relieve discomfort.

Stained and Discolored TeethLearn More ➝
Discoloration can be caused by food, drinks, smoking, medication, or natural aging. We brighten smiles with professional whitening, veneers, or bonding, giving you a clean, radiant look that enhances confidence.

Bad BreathLearn More ➝
Persistent bad breath may be linked to gum disease, dry mouth, or poor hygiene. We address the underlying cause with thorough cleanings, periodontal therapy, and personalized hygiene guidance to freshen your breath and support overall health.

Orofacial PainLearn More ➝
Jaw pain, clenching, or grinding (bruxism) can wear down teeth and cause headaches or muscle strain. We provide custom night guards, bite adjustments, and treatment strategies to relieve discomfort and protect your smile.

Sleeping IssuesLearn More ➝
Snoring, fatigue, or disrupted sleep can sometimes be signs of sleep apnea or airway obstruction. We help improve sleep with custom oral appliances, lifestyle guidance, and referrals to specialists when necessary.

Gum DiseaseLearn More ➝
Plaque buildup can lead to gum inflammation and infection, which may damage gum tissue and supporting bone. We treat gum disease with deep cleanings, scaling and root planing, and periodontal maintenance to protect your oral health.
